Applications close: 06/10/2026 9:00 PM The Department for Infrastructure and Transport plays a vital role connecting people and places in South Australia by managing roads, marine and public transport networks across the State, and builds and maintains the State-owned infrastructure that enables the delivery of essential and important government services to our community.
The Building Projects Directorate delivers advisory, project management and support services for the delivery and management of South Australian Government social infrastructure projects.
Coordinates and supports programs, projects and administrative services within Building Projects, including stakeholder engagement, reporting, research and records management. We seek a highly organised, proactive and customer-focused candidate with strong communication
skills, attention to detail, sound judgement, and the ability to build effective relationships and manage competing priorities. The candidate will be digitally literate with skills in website design, SharePoint design and implementation and familiarity
with Records Management processes.
